Uruguay is set to experience a day of widespread cloudiness and instability on Sunday, August 16, 2026, according to the Uruguayan Institute of Meteorology (Inumet). National temperatures are expected to fluctuate between a low of 11°C and a high of 26°C.

The northwest region will see overcast skies throughout the day, accompanied by fog, mist, and precipitation, including thunderstorms. Winds will generally blow from the east at 10-30 km/h, with periods of variable winds and strong gusts linked to the storms. The afternoon and evening forecast indicates continued cloud cover with temporary improvements, fog, mist, rain, and thunderstorms, with winds increasing to 10-40 km/h.

In the northeast, the morning will be overcast with fog, mist, rain, and thunderstorms. Winds will be from the northeast at 10-30 km/h. The afternoon and evening will maintain overcast conditions with fog, mist, rain, and thunderstorms, and winds from the east at 10-30 km/h, featuring strong gusts.

The southwest region will start with cloudy to overcast skies, fog, mist, and isolated showers and thunderstorms. Winds will shift from the northeast to the south at 10-20 km/h. The afternoon and evening will persist with cloudiness, fog, mist, isolated rain, and thunderstorms, with winds from the south to southeast at 10-30 km/h and gusts up to 40 km/h.

Central-south areas will begin with cloudy to overcast skies, fog, mist, and isolated rain and thunderstorms. Winds will move from the northeast to the south at 10-30 km/h. The afternoon and evening forecast predicts abundant cloudiness, temporary improvements, fog, mist, isolated rain, and thunderstorms, with variable winds settling from the southeast at 5-30 km/h.

In the east, the morning will be overcast with fog, mist, rain, and isolated thunderstorms, with winds from the north at 10-40 km/h. The afternoon and evening will remain overcast with fog, mist, rain, and thunderstorms, as winds shift from the north to the south at 10-30 km/h. Punta del Este will also experience overcast conditions with fog, rain, and isolated thunderstorms, with winds shifting from the northeast to the southwest.
